body {
	background-color: hsl(200,100%,30%);

}

h1 {
	
	text-align: left;
	padding: 80px 16px 110px 16px; 
	margin: 16px 0px;
	text-indent: 6vw;
	position: relative; 
	
	background-image: url(../mountains1.jpg);
	background-size: cover;
	background-position: 50% 40%;
}

h1 > span {
	background-color: hsla(200,100%,100%,.6);
	display: block; 
	padding-top: 4px;
	padding-bottom: 4px;
	text-shadow: 2px 1px 4px #666;
}


h1 > a {
	position: absolute;
	border: 2px solid green;
	display: block;
	width: fit-content;
}

h1 > a:nth-of-type(1) {
	border: 2px solid orange;
	bottom: 48px; right: 16px;
}

h1 > a:nth-of-type(2) {
	border: 2px solid purple;
	bottom: 48px; right: 154px;
}


h2 {
	
	text-align: left;
	padding: 80px 16px 110px 16px; 
	margin: 16px 0px;
	text-indent: 6vw;
	position: relative; 
	
	background-image: url(../forest.jpg);
	background-size: cover;
	background-position: 50% 50%;
}

h2 > span {
	background-color: hsla(200,100%,100%,.6);
	display: block; 
	padding-top: 4px;
	padding-bottom: 4px;
	text-shadow: 2px 1px 4px #666;
}

h3 {
	
	text-align: left;
	padding: 80px 16px 110px 16px; 
	margin: 16px 0px;
	text-indent: 6vw;
	position: relative; 
	
	background-image: url(../sunrise.jpg);
	background-size: cover;
	background-position: 50% 50%;
}

h3 > span {
	background-color: hsla(200,100%,100%,.6);
	display: block; 
	padding-top: 4px;
	padding-bottom: 4px;
	text-shadow: 2px 1px 4px #666;
}


h4 {
	
	text-align: left;
	padding: 80px 16px 110px 16px; 
	margin: 16px 0px;
	text-indent: 6vw;
	position: relative; 
	
	background-image: url(../lake.jpg);
	background-size: cover;
	background-position: 50% 40%;
}

h4 > span {
	background-color: hsla(200,100%,100%,.6);
	display: block; 
	padding-top: 4px;
	padding-bottom: 4px;
	text-shadow: 2px 1px 4px #666;
}

h5 {
	text-align: left;
	padding: 80px 16px 110px 16px; 
	margin: 16px 0px;
	text-indent: 6vw;
	position: relative; 
	
	background-image: url(../road.jpg);
	background-size: cover;
	background-position: 50% 40%;
}

h5 > span {
	background-color: hsla(200,100%,100%,.6);
	display: block; 
	padding-top: 4px;
	padding-bottom: 4px;
	text-shadow: 2px 1px 4px #666;
}

h6 {
	text-align: left;
	padding: 80px 16px 110px 16px; 
	margin: 16px 0px;
	text-indent: 6vw;
	position: relative; 
	
	background-image: url(../river.jpg);
	background-size: cover;
	background-position: 50% 90%;
}

h6 > span {
	background-color: hsla(200,100%,100%,.6);
	display: block; 
	padding-top: 4px;
	padding-bottom: 4px;
	text-shadow: 2px 1px 4px #666;
}


h8 {
	
	text-align: left;
	padding: 80px 16px 110px 16px; 
	margin: 16px 0px;
	text-indent: 6vw;
	position: relative; 
	
	background-image: url(../rocks.jpg);
	background-size: cover;
	background-position: 50% 50%;
}

h8 > span {
	background-color: hsla(200,100%,100%,.6);
	display: block; 
	padding-top: 4px;
	padding-bottom: 4px;
	text-shadow: 2px 1px 4px #666;
}
